Q: What is the key difference between R901496432 (/24A1) and R901496438 (/24F1)?
A: The control signal type. R901496432 (/24A1) accepts ±10 V voltage input, while R901496438 (/24F1) accepts 4–20 mA current input. They are otherwise identical in mechanical construction, flow capacity (32 L/min), and mounting dimensions. Do not mix these versions without a signal converter.
Q: Can I use this valve with a PLC that has a 4–20 mA analog output?
A: No, not directly. The /24A1 suffix specifically requires a ±10 V voltage signal. If your controller outputs 4–20 mA, you should use the /24F1 version (R901496438) or add a signal converter.
Q: What is the advantage of the "W" spool in this high-flow valve?
A: The W spool has overlap (positive overlap), which creates a small dead zone around the center position. This provides excellent low-flow metering characteristics and smooth acceleration, which is critical for high-flow applications like press feeds or crane hoisting.
Q: Is an external amplifier card (e.g., VT-VSPA1) required?
A: No. The "4WREE" series features Integrated On-Board Electronics (OBE), meaning the amplifier and closed-loop control circuitry are built into the valve. You connect the 24V power and ±10V signal directly to the valve's 7-pin connector.
Q: What is the critical installation note for the drain port?
A: The Y port (drain) must be connected directly to the tank without any pressure. It drains internal leakage oil and provides a reference pressure for the LVDT sensor. A blocked drain line can lead to erratic spool movement, loss of control, and seal damage.
Q: Is the mounting interface the same as other NG6 proportional valves?
A: Yes. The "3X" in the model number confirms it uses the standardized ISO 4401-03-02-0-05 mounting interface. It is directly interchangeable with other NG6 "3X" series valves without modifying the subplate.
